quote:

There is no reason to play Jenning if Harris can run the offense


Yes there is. You make a good point about the QBs being stylistically similar, but you miss something that fans often misunderstand about college ball - they don't get enough practice time. So, if you want to install a lot, you need to use different personnel.

Contrary to what most LSU fans think, the Tigers have a complex offense. This is why the freshman LF got so few carries last year, it's because each week he probably only had about 60% of the game plan mastered. Similarly, this year there might be some packages that BH won't be good at, so they might alternate in AJ every now and then when they think they need that package to exploit the defense.
